The first edition of this H.G. Wells novel inscribed by the author to the novelist Dennis Wheatley on the half-title. Recased in 1/4 cloth and marbled boards and as such a fine copy. Laid down on the spine is the title from the original cloth binding. Loosely laid in is Wheatley's ex-libris designed by Frank Pape.
Provenance: This copy came from the library of Dennis Wheatley and was bought from the Blackwell catalogue which featured Wheatley's collection of largely modern literature. When bought it was a fine copy in the original green cloth and dustwrapper. The binding and dustwrapper were subsequently badly chewed by an active puppy (on a low shelf of a bookcase) - hence the rebind. Internally the contents are fine.
